Reports to: Director of Care The RN plays a pivotal role in enriching the lives of residents by supporting the LTC Home in the administration of medications, treatments, and assessments. This role actively participates in all multidisciplinary meetings to ensure excellence in resident care and continuous improvement in nursing practices. The RN plays a key role in enhancing the effective management and quality of nursing practice in alignment with: College of Nurses of Ontario Standards Long-Term Care Standards Southbridge Care Homes Standards Ensure resident care is provided with established nursing standards and principles, physicians’ orders and administrative policies, as well as observe, report and record vital signs, symptoms and conditions of residents.
Assure observance of required techniques in nursing care. Assist in assessing residents and develop, implement, review and evaluate resident care plans. Monitor residents’ health,
notes changes in condition and assess need for referral to doctors; processes and implement physicians’ orders.
Plan, direct, supervise and evaluate the work of nursing and personal care staff assigned to the unit. Monitor performance and conduct performance appraisal and refers problems to the Director of Care. Assist in preparing the Facility for RAI MDS.
Take charge of the Facility in the absence of the Director of Care. Staff replacement in the absence of the care clerk. Appropriate current certificate of competence from the College of Nurses of Ontario required.
Registration or eligible for registration with the Registered Nurses Association of Ontario.
Current First
Aid and BLS Certificate Previous managerial experience in long-term care preferred. Comprehensive knowledge of nursing and health care practices, as well as Knowledge in Infection Control Practices. Demonstrated commitment to working with seniors.
Ability to work effectively individually and with others while prioritizing tasks to handle the most urgent first. Ability to present information clearly and effectively both verbally whether in person or over the phone, and in writing; an active listener who projects a friendly demeanor. puts information from various sources together to see the ‘big picture’ and generate creative solutions. Organizational, planning, time management and multi-tasking skills.
If you have no documentation on a previous Tuberculin Skin Test (TST) or you did a TST greater than 12 months ago, a negative 2-step TST is necessary.
